According to some data from Fortune Business Insights, AR marketing was born as a concept in 2019 and by 2021 recorded investments of $9.45 billion; the following year it rose to $13.72 billion.
This rapid increase authorizes predictions regarding the future expansion that this market will continue to have.

Why Is AR Taking Over?

AR isn’t just for gaming anymore—it’s becoming a mainstream marketing tool. Here’s why brands and consumers are embracing it:

  • Chiefly improved Shopping Experiences: AR allows customers to try on clothes, makeup, or even furniture in their homes before making a purchase.
  • Interactive Social Media Filters: Platforms like Instagram and Snapchat have made AR effects a daily part of online transmission.
  • Ultra-fast-Individualized Content: Brands can now create interactive, appropriate videos that adjust derived from user preferences.

Big Brands Are New the AR Revolution

Companies like Nike, IKEA, and Sephora are already employing AR to develop their marketing strategies. Instead of just watching an ad, customers can engage with it—whether that means “trying on” sneakers through a phone screen or seeing how a couch fits in their living room.

The Possible (and Pitfalls) of an AR-Dominated World

Although AR brings exciting likelihoods, there are also concerns:

Pros of AR in Marketing Cons of AR in Marketing
Immersive and engaging experiences Privacy concerns with data collection
Increases customer interaction Can feel overwhelming or intrusive
Makes brands more memorable Requires expensive development
Creates personalized advertising Risk of digital addiction

As AR continues to grow, brands will need to find a balance between engagement and over-saturation. When does AR improve reality, and when does it replace it?

Our editing team Is still asking these questions

1. What is AR video marketing?

AR video marketing is when you decide to use augmented reality technology to create interactive and engrossing advertising experiences. It allows viewers to engage with content in real-time rather than just passively watching.

2. How is AR different from Video Reality (VR)?

AR improves the practical sphere by overlaying video elements, although VR creates a completely engrossing video engagement zone. AR keeps you in reality, although VR transports you elsewhere.

3. How can small businesses use AR for marketing?

Even without big budgets, small businesses can exploit with finesse AR by employing social media filters, QR code activations, and interactive video content to engage customers.

4. What industries benefit the most from AR marketing?

Industries like retail, fashion, real estate, entertainment, and automotive benefit the most because AR allows customers to visualize products in a distinctive way.

5. Is AR marketing expensive?

Although high-end AR experiences need investment, many affordable tools (such as Spark AR for Instagram or WebAR solutions) make AR marketing accessible even for smaller brands.

Brand promotion

  1. Social Media Stories and Reels: Plat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and TikTok thrive on short, snappy video content. Use these features to showcase product launches, behind-the-scenes snippets, and customer testimonials.
  2. YouTube Channel: Create a dedicated YouTube channel for brand promotion. Post a variety of content, from how-to guides and product demonstrations to engaging vlogs that reflect your brand's personality.
  3. Live Streaming: Host live events on platforms such as Facebook Live or Instagram Live. Engage with your audience in real-time for product announcements, Q&A sessions, or interactive tutorials, offering a direct avenue for brand promotion.
  4. Video Testimonials: Encourage satisfied customers to share their experiences on video. These authentic reviews can be used on your website, social media, and email marketing campaigns for impactful brand promotion.
  5. Email Campaigns: Embed videos in your newsletters and promotional emails. Video content increases click-through rates and keeps your subscribers engaged, thereby boosting brand promotion efforts.
  6. Landing Page Videos: Feature a video on your landing page that succinctly conveys your brand message or product benefits. This strategy can increase conversion rates by keeping visitors on your site longer.
  7. Product Tutorials: Use instructional videos to show how your products work. These can be used across social media, your website, and YouTube to support brand promotion by educating and engaging your audience.
  8. Virtual Reality and 360-Degree Videos: For an immersive brand promotion experience, create VR or 360-degree videos. This technology is perfect for showcasing products or destinations, giving viewers an interactive way to engage with your brand.
  9. Webinars: Host educational webinars that offer value to your audience. Not only do they establish your authority, but they also promote your brand by positioning you as an industry expert.
  10. User-Generated Content: Encourage your audience to create and share their own videos featuring your products. This not only enhances brand promotion through word-of-mouth but also fosters community engagement.
  11. Influencer Collaborations: Partner with influencers to reach new audiences through their established followings. Influencer-created video content can greatly amplify your brand promotion efforts.
  12. Ad Campaigns: Invest in video ads on platforms like YouTube, Facebook, and Instagram. Video ads are more likely to be viewed and remembered than other ad formats, making them a potent tool for brand promotion.
